Clear All Filters
Pink Beach Coverup Shirt With Linen
£32
Love & Roses White and Navy Embroidered Stripe Jersey Long Sleeve 100% Cotton Top
£24
Joules Amilla Pink & White Stripe Longline Relaxed Fit Shirt
£55
Joules Amilla Tan & White Stripe Longline Relaxed Fit Shirt
Yours Curve Brown Grown On Sleeve 100% Cotton Top
£20
Friends Like These Pink Cotton Poplin Stripe Dimante Shirt
£38
Nike Royal Blue Oversized Sportswear Phoenix Fleece Mini Swoosh Pullover Hoodie
£60
Pink Stripe and White Maternity Nursing T-Shirts 2 Pack
£42
Nike Light Grey Oversized Phoenix Fleece Graphic Long Crew Neck Sweatshirt
Nike White Oversized Sportswear Essential Long-Sleeve T-Shirt
Lauren Ralph Lauren Kotta Striped Relaxed Fit Shirt
£179